Forum RSS Feed Follow @ Twitter Follow On Facebook

Thread Rating:
  • 0 Vote(s) -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
[-]
Welcome
You have to register before you can post on our site.

Username:


Password:





[-]
Latest Threads
[REQUEST] Acer TravelMate 5760(G,Z) BIOS...
Last Post: quibic
Today 01:03 AM
» Replies: 49
» Views: 26356
Asus P8Z77-M RT-d Unlock
Last Post: cbaldwin1
Yesterday 04:21 PM
» Replies: 0
» Views: 149
Yoga 530-14arr smt option
Last Post: Dudu2002
Yesterday 02:04 PM
» Replies: 1
» Views: 141
[REQUEST] Gigabyte GA-X99P-SLI BIOS with...
Last Post: DKisCRUSHIN
Yesterday 09:50 AM
» Replies: 0
» Views: 122
Acer Aspire 5920G - Requesting Modded BI...
Last Post: EbrahimSiami
07-10-2025 02:56 PM
» Replies: 1
» Views: 314
Acer A517-51G-58S5 - Complete BIOS image...
Last Post: Humboldt
07-10-2025 01:07 PM
» Replies: 2
» Views: 176
i7 2860QM how to raise power limit?
Last Post: DeathBringer
07-10-2025 07:03 AM
» Replies: 10
» Views: 487
Lenovo Yoga Pro 7 14ASP9 Bios Unlock
Last Post: Dudu2002
07-10-2025 03:02 AM
» Replies: 3
» Views: 288
[RESOLVED] Help! BIOS for Asus GL503VS R...
Last Post: AmosNZ
07-10-2025 12:09 AM
» Replies: 5
» Views: 2988
[REQUEST] Acer Predator Helios 500 PH517...
Last Post: TeckToe
07-09-2025 11:29 PM
» Replies: 4
» Views: 1491
Gigabyte G6X 9MG insydeH2O IOS Unlock
Last Post: Zzhheennyyaa
07-09-2025 04:37 PM
» Replies: 2
» Views: 626
[SOLVED] Lenovo IdeaPad 510-15ISK - BIOS...
Last Post: outsydeh2o
07-09-2025 09:39 AM
» Replies: 1
» Views: 330
(new to forums) searching for aid/direct...
Last Post: adorable_yangire
07-09-2025 12:11 AM
» Replies: 0
» Views: 262
[SOLVED] Change Serial Number, UUID, Mac...
Last Post: dsdn1
07-08-2025 07:55 PM
» Replies: 10
» Views: 16891
[REQUEST] Lenovo G50-45 BIOS Unlock
Last Post: szakiz
07-08-2025 05:36 PM
» Replies: 49
» Views: 53480
[REQUEST] Lenovo Yoga 7 Pro 82Y7 unlock
Last Post: Dudu2002
07-08-2025 07:13 AM
» Replies: 1
» Views: 272
[REQUEST] Lenovo G710 BIOS Whitelist Rem...
Last Post: Dudu2002
07-08-2025 07:12 AM
» Replies: 491
» Views: 217842
Lenovo Y550 BIOS Unlocking (Advanced Men...
Last Post: kentsergeo
07-08-2025 12:15 AM
» Replies: 5
» Views: 1162
[REQUEST] Acer Aspire 8930(G) BIOS Unloc...
Last Post: Ilias manolopoulos
07-07-2025 01:52 PM
» Replies: 58
» Views: 43724
ASUS M11AD > Haswell Refresh
Last Post: JCY1962
07-07-2025 12:40 PM
» Replies: 22
» Views: 7793

[REQUEST] HP Mini 5102 wlan whitelist removal
#1
Hey guys, I'm hoping to remove the BIOS whitelist on my HP mini 5102. The wifi card at the moment is a Broadcom 43224 (vendor id 14e4, device id 4353). I'm hoping to replace this with an Intel 6235 (It's being delivered, so I don't have the PCI id for this unfortunately).

My current BIOS is available here: ftp://ftp.hp.com/pub/softpaq/sp54501-55000/sp54640.exe . It is version 68PGU.F20. I was going to modify it myself, but I realised it was a "ROMPAQ" bios, and I couldn't find any guides for this. The user camiloml was able to remove the whitelist for a ROMPAQ bios here: http://www.bios-mods.com/forum/Thread-Re...-Mini-2140 , so if he or someone else could at least get me started, it would really be appreciated.

If any more info is needed about my system, just ask.

Thanks in advance,

ryley

EDIT: Andy's Phonextool reports this BIOS as being an "Insyde BIOS" and as far as I can tell, its not encrypted
find
quote
#2
(06-29-2012, 12:09 AM)ryley Wrote: Hey guys, I'm hoping to remove the BIOS whitelist on my HP mini 5102. The wifi card at the moment is a Broadcom 43224 (vendor id 14e4, device id 4353). I'm hoping to replace this with an Intel 6235 (It's being delivered, so I don't have the PCI id for this unfortunately).

My current BIOS is available here: ftp://ftp.hp.com/pub/softpaq/sp54501-55000/sp54640.exe . It is version 68PGU.F20. I was going to modify it myself, but I realised it was a "ROMPAQ" bios, and I couldn't find any guides for this. The user camiloml was able to remove the whitelist for a ROMPAQ bios here: http://www.bios-mods.com/forum/Thread-Re...-Mini-2140 , so if he or someone else could at least get me started, it would really be appreciated.

If any more info is needed about my system, just ask.

Thanks in advance,

ryley

EDIT: Andy's Phonextool reports this BIOS as being an "Insyde BIOS" and as far as I can tell, its not encrypted


If anyone could provide me with any assistance, it really would be greatly appreciated. I've made absolutely no progress with this unfortunately and I'm really eager to remove this whitelist
find
quote
#3
I think I might have made some progress on this! Using the advice on searching for the PCI ID found here: http://forums.mydigitallife.info/archive...20223.html , I was able to find several occurences of what I think are mentions of my Broadcom WLAN card! (Card is 14e4:4353, hex string is e4145343). Also occurring several times in the same region are a few other scrambled Broadcom WLAN PCI IDs, as well as several Intel WLAN PCI IDs! I replaced all the occurences of an Intel card's ID with the ID of the Intel 6235 (I figured this was better than replacing my current cards ID). I used HxD for all of this. I saved the Rom.bin file, but now I'm not too sure how to replace the Rom.bin file in the Rom cab archive with my modified Rom.

Could someone please advise me if I'm on the right track with this, and if so, could someone please suggest how to flash this modified Rom.bin file?
find
quote
#4
Ok, I replaced all scrambled instances of some intel wlan cards pci id (including the subsys part) with the scrambled pci id and subsys id of my Intel 6235. I then tried using a patched version of HPQFlash that I think I got from here (4.30.2?) to flash the Rom.cab file I made with CabPack, but it failed flashing it after attempting 3 times. HPQFlash said the BIOS was corrupted, so I reinstalled my current BIOS before restarting. The HPQFlash program bundled with the BIOS's HP released late last year seems to be a fair bit newer/different (version 4.40?). The system rebooted fine, but now I'm back to where I started. I've noticed in a lot of the modded bioses on this site there are files like "3660F24.fd" in the packages and they are flashed with InsydeFlash. I tried to install my modded Rom.bin file with InsydeFlash (after changing the name in platform.ini), but InsydeFlash couldn't flash it, it just mentioned SMI and exited.

I'm willing to try anything to get this working, and if someone could help at all it would be massively appreciated.
find
quote
#5
After successfully patching the BIOS with ADDCC v3 to maintain the checksum after changing the whitelist and to have HPQFlash still complain, I'm out of ideas. If anyone has any ideas, I'll try anything.

ryley
find
quote
#6
My latest idea of using hpqflash (tried versions 4.30, 4.30-patched, 4.40 and 4.50) along with OllyDbg to interrupt the flashing process immediately after writing my modded bios, but before the verification. A few times it appeared to work, but unfortunately the unmodded bios is still in use. Still thinking of and open to new ideas!
find
quote
#7
So I've given up on adding the Intel 6235 to my BIOS whitelist. Instead, I'm thinking of buying an Intel 6200 Wi-Fi card. I can see several references to it's pci id in the original bios file, so does this mean the card should work? Or do some BIOS' have a whitelist as well as a blacklist? Also, should I get the card specifically targeted towards HP/Lenovo or the generic one? My BIOS contains all of the pci id's I could find for this card.
find
quote
#8
Hey guys, just posting to say that despite the Intel 6200 not being in my HP netbook's service manual, it's PCI ID did appear in the BIOS whitelist and it does actually work! I have a HP 5102 on the latest, unmodified BIOS. So if you aren't sure if a card will work, check if it's mentioned in the whitelist and if it is, give it a go! So happy to know have 802.11abgn in Linux with powersave and injection support!
find
quote
#9
I found my old HP Mini 5102 in storage the other day and remembered all the trouble I had with the BIOS, so I've been having another look at this out of curiosity. None of the patched flashers available can even flash the original BIOS image for my HP, so using IDA I've been trying to patch the good flasher myself. So far I've been able to change some parts of how the eROMPAQ.exe flasher works but I'm still unable to get it to flash a modified BIOS. When using the good eROMPAQ with a modified BIOS it attempts to "buffer" the BIOS three times before giving up. I think the function sub_10F3A (when called in sub_11A6C at loc_11BC2) is what causes my issue as when I force the jump to loc_11C16 it doesn't loop three times (but still fails to flash).

At this point I'm not too fussed about bricking the laptop, so I'm happy to try anything anyone could suggest or provide in terms of a patched eROMPAQ or even HPQFlash. The original HP BIOS package (with the only known good flasher) is available here: ftp://ftp.hp.com/pub/softpaq/sp57501-58000/sp57757.exe .

Ryley
find
quote
#10
All these HP laptop's Bioses are moddable but not reflashable so only using
and HW SPI Prorammer and a Pomona Soic Clip is possible to do this job !
Get these tools and I will help You !
Look here :

https://www.bios-mods.com/forum/Thread-R...5#pid74575

Let me know
Regards

[size=undefined]Your Brain [/size]. . . . It's the best tool U can use ! Wink
[size=undefined]Don't FLASH the Bios Mod if You get a Size Alert, You risk a Brick !!! [/size]
Donate to me for my work, click here BDM
find
quote


Forum Jump:


Users browsing this thread: 1 Guest(s)